Solve an initial relaxed (noninteger) problem using Linear Programming. Perform Mixed-Integer Program Preprocessing to tighten the LP relaxation of the mixed-integer problem. Try Cut Generation to further tighten the LP relaxation of the mixed-integer problem. Try to find integer-feasible solutions us...
